Output 577e99e726961c658257d2913f30df7aff5ba8a53205211ff08951117d192036:5

value
134428098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c5dd79326f0bff8d81d08e383722fb58efbc9ce OP_EQUAL
address
3MnD11UtGQjCCT9mCCCBsAubU7wE1K4pzc
transaction
577e99e726961c658257d2913f30df7aff5ba8a53205211ff08951117d192036
spent
true